From 2526d1ee4b7b740b5f5786c25638ee1528d425be Mon Sep 17 00:00:00 2001 From: Willem Melching Date: Mon, 16 Sep 2024 15:56:28 +0200 Subject: [PATCH] UDS: Fix Write Data by Address (#2023) --- python/uds.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/python/uds.py b/python/uds.py index b5439446cd..612eb206b0 100644 --- a/python/uds.py +++ b/python/uds.py @@ -820,7 +820,7 @@ def write_memory_by_address(self, memory_address: int, memory_size: int, data_re data += struct.pack('!I', memory_size)[4 - memory_size_bytes:] data += data_record - self._uds_request(SERVICE_TYPE.WRITE_MEMORY_BY_ADDRESS, subfunction=0x00, data=data) + self._uds_request(SERVICE_TYPE.WRITE_MEMORY_BY_ADDRESS, subfunction=None, data=data) def clear_diagnostic_information(self, dtc_group_type: DTC_GROUP_TYPE): data = struct.pack('!I', dtc_group_type)[1:] # 3 bytes